Episode 200 of One Piece , titled , is a standout installment within the G-8 Arc—often cited as the gold standard for "filler" content in anime. While most filler arcs feel like a detour, Episode 200 maintains the series' core charm by blending high-stakes tension with the Straw Hats' signature comedic absurdity. The G-8 arc is praised for its writing, specifically Vice Admiral Jonathan, who acts as a "worthy" tactical adversary rather than a typical cartoonish villain.

Luffy and Sanji infiltrate the jail to rescue Zoro and Usopp. The dynamic between the duo is a highlight, as they attempt to sneak around a high-security base with varying degrees of success.
